Output d8245d8836701d4bb9246c859bf62e601a123e39c3c4fd15dc34a4ffdf9dce08:0

value
172240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531a379a89beb558544d80a4bdb86f60c2250be0 OP_EQUAL
address
39GRR4wgVAoSRAhT5zgqsbXPw2tEQbjL8a
transaction
d8245d8836701d4bb9246c859bf62e601a123e39c3c4fd15dc34a4ffdf9dce08
confirmations
142244
spent
true